package com.squareup.square.legacy.api;

import com.fasterxml.jackson.core.JsonProcessingException;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.ApiHelper;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.Server;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.exceptions.ApiException;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.http.client.HttpContext;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.http.request.HttpMethod;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.BatchChangeInventoryRequest;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.BatchChangeInventoryRes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.RetrieveInventoryAdjustmentRes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.RetrieveInventoryChangesRes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.RetrieveInventoryCountRes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.RetrieveInventoryPhysicalCountResponse;
import com.squareup.square.legacy.models.RetrieveInventoryTransferResponse;
import io.apimatic.core.ApiCall;
import io.apimatic.core.GlobalConfiguration;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.util.concurrent.CompletableFuture;
import java.util.concurrent.CompletionException;

/**
 * This class lists all the endpoints of the groups.
 */
public final class DefaultInventoryApi extends BaseApi implements InventoryApi {

    /**
     * Initializes the controller.
     * @param globalConfig    Configurations added in client.
     */
    public DefaultInventoryApi(GlobalConfiguration globalConfig) {
        super(globalConfig);
    }

    /**
     * Applies adjustments and counts to the provided item quantities. On success: returns the
     * current calculated counts for all objects referenced in the request. On failure: returns a
     * list of related errors.
     * @param  body  Required parameter: An object containing the fields to POST for the request.
     *         See the corresponding object definition for field details.
     * @return    Returns the BatchChangeInventoryResponse response from the API call
     * @throws    ApiException    Represents error response from the server.
     * @throws    IOException    Signals that an I/O exception of some sort has occurred.
     */
    public BatchChangeInventoryResponse batchChangeInventory(final BatchChangeInventoryRequest body)
            throws ApiException, IOException {
        return prepareBatchChangeInventoryRequest(body).execute();
    }

    /**
     * Applies adjustments and counts to the provided item quantities. On success: returns the
     * current calculated counts for all objects referenced in the request. On failure: returns a
     * list of related errors.
     * @param  body  Required parameter: An object containing the fields to POST for the request.
     *         See the corresponding object definition for field details.
     * @return    Returns the BatchChangeInventoryResponse response from the API call
     */
    public CompletableFuture batchChangeInventoryAsync(
            final BatchChangeInventoryRequest body) {
        try {
            return prepareBatchChangeInventoryRequest(body).executeAsync();
        } catch (Exception e) {
            throw new CompletionException(e);
        }
    }

    /**
     * Builds the ApiCall object for batchChangeInventory.
     */
    private ApiCall prepareBatchChangeInventoryRequest(
            final BatchChangeInventoryRequest body) throws JsonProcessingException, IOException {
        return new ApiCall.Builder()
                .globalConfig(getGlobalConfiguration())
                .requestBuilder(requestBuilder -> requestBuilder
                        .server(Server.ENUM_DEFAULT.value())
                        .path("/v2/inventory/changes/batch-create")
                        .bodyParam(param -> param.value(body))
                        .bodySerializer(() -> ApiHelper.serialize(body))
                        .headerParam(param -> param.key("Content-Type")
                                .value("application/json")
                                .isRequired(false))
                        .headerParam(param -> param.key("accept").value("application/json"))
                        .withAuth(auth -> auth.add("global"))
                        .httpMethod(HttpMethod.POST))
                .responseHandler(responseHandler -> responseHandler
                        .deserializer(response -> ApiHelper.deserialize(response, BatchChangeInventoryResponse.class))
                        .nullify404(false)
                        .contextInitializer((context, result) -> result.toBuilder()
                                .httpContext((HttpContext) context)
                                .build())
                        .globalErrorCase(GLOBAL_ERROR_CASES))
                .build();
    }

    /**
     * Returns historical physical counts and adjustments based on the provided filter criteria.
     * Results are paginated and sorted in ascending order according their `occurred_at` timestamp
     * (oldest first). BatchRetrieveInventoryChanges is a catch-all query endpoint for queries that
     * cannot be handled by other, simpler endpoints.
     * @param  body  Required parameter: An object containing the fields to POST for the request.
     *         See the corresponding object definition for field details.
     * @return    Returns the B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esResponse response from the API call
     * @throws    ApiException    Represents error response from the server.
     * @throws    IOException    Signals that an I/O exception of some sort has occurred.
     */
    public B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esResponse batchRetrieveInventoryChanges(
            final B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est body) throws ApiException, IOException {
        return prepareBat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est(body).execute();
    }

    /**
     * Returns historical physical counts and adjustments based on the provided filter criteria.
     * Results are paginated and sorted in ascending order according their `occurred_at` timestamp
     * (oldest first). BatchRetrieveInventoryChanges is a catch-all query endpoint for queries that
     * cannot be handled by other, simpler endpoints.
     * @param  body  Required parameter: An object containing the fields to POST for the request.
     *         See the corresponding object definition for field details.
     * @return    Returns the B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esResponse response from the API call
     */
    public CompletableFuture batchRetrieveInventoryChangesAsync(
            final B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est body) {
        try {
            return prepareBat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est(body).executeAsync();
        } catch (Exception e) {
            throw new CompletionException(e);
        }
    }

    /**
     * Builds the ApiCall object for batchRetrieveInventoryChanges.
     */
    private ApiCall prepareBat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est(
            final B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esRequest body) throws JsonProcessingException, IOException {
        return new ApiCall.Builder()
                .globalConfig(getGlobalConfiguration())
                .requestBuilder(requestBuilder -> requestBuilder
                        .server(Server.ENUM_DEFAULT.value())
                        .path("/v2/inventory/changes/batch-retrieve")
                        .bodyParam(param -> param.value(body))
                        .bodySerializer(() -> ApiHelper.serialize(body))
                        .headerParam(param -> param.key("Content-Type")
                                .value("application/json")
                                .isRequired(false))
                        .headerParam(param -> param.key("accept").value("application/json"))
                        .withAuth(auth -> auth.add("global"))
                        .httpMethod(HttpMethod.POST))
                .responseHandler(responseHandler -> responseHandler
                        .deserializer(response ->
                                ApiHelper.deserialize(response, BatchRetrieveInventoryChangesResponse.class))
                        .nullify404(false)
                        .contextInitializer((context, result) -> result.toBuilder()
                                .httpContext((HttpContext) context)
                                .build())
                        .globalErrorCase(GLOBAL_ERROR_CASES))
                .build();
    }

    /**
     * Returns current counts for the provided [CatalogObject]($m/CatalogObject)s at the requested
     * [Location]($m/Location)s. Results are paginated and sorted in descending order according to
     * their `calculated_at` timestamp (newest first). When `updated_after` is specified, only
     * counts that have changed since that time (based on the server timestamp for the most recent
     * change) are returned. This allows clients to perform a "sync" operation, for example in
     * response to receiving a Webhook notification.
     * @param  body  Required parameter: An object containing the fields to POST for the request.
     *         See the corresponding object definition for field details.
     * @return    Returns the B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sResponse response from the API call
     * @throws    ApiException    Represents error response from the server.
     * @throws    IOException    Signals that an I/O exception of some sort has occurred.
     */
    public B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sResponse batchRetrieveInventoryCounts(
            final B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est body) throws ApiException, IOException {
        return prepareBat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est(body).execute();
    }

    /**
     * Returns current counts for the provided [CatalogObject]($m/CatalogObject)s at the requested
     * [Location]($m/Location)s. Results are paginated and sorted in descending order according to
     * their `calculated_at` timestamp (newest first). When `updated_after` is specified, only
     * counts that have changed since that time (based on the server timestamp for the most recent
     * change) are returned. This allows clients to perform a "sync" operation, for example in
     * response to receiving a Webhook notification.
     * @param  body  Required parameter: An object containing the fields to POST for the request.
     *         See the corresponding object definition for field details.
     * @return    Returns the B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sResponse response from the API call
     */
    public CompletableFuture batchRetrieveInventoryCountsAsync(
            final B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est body) {
        try {
            return prepareBat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est(body).executeAsync();
        } catch (Exception e) {
            throw new CompletionException(e);
        }
    }

    /**
     * Builds the ApiCall object for batchRetrieveInventoryCounts.
     */
    private ApiCall prepareBat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est(
            final B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sRequest body) throws JsonProcessingException, IOException {
        return new ApiCall.Builder()
                .globalConfig(getGlobalConfiguration())
                .requestBuilder(requestBuilder -> requestBuilder
                        .server(Server.ENUM_DEFAULT.value())
                        .path("/v2/inventory/counts/batch-retrieve")
                        .bodyParam(param -> param.value(body))
                        .bodySerializer(() -> ApiHelper.serialize(body))
                        .headerParam(param -> param.key("Content-Type")
                                .value("application/json")
                                .isRequired(false))
                        .headerParam(param -> param.key("accept").value("application/json"))
                        .withAuth(auth -> auth.add("global"))
                        .httpMethod(HttpMethod.POST))
                .responseHandler(responseHandler -> responseHandler
                        .deserializer(
                                response -> ApiHelper.deserialize(response, BatchRetrieveInventoryCountsResponse.class))
                        .nullify404(false)
                        .contextInitializer((context, result) -> result.toBuilder()
                                .httpContext((HttpContext) context)
                                .build())
                        .globalErrorCase(GLOBAL_ERROR_CASES))
                .build();
    }
